All fees listed are the maximum amounts charged per pupil for each activity, class or athletics participation. Actual costs are determined by the local school and may vary. All monies spent for each group or activity, including student contributions, fund raisers and donations, must be counted as part of the maximum cost per student for each group or activity. These fees, with the exception of camps, do not include additional costs of any overnight travel. For school  activities and athletics that require fees, tryouts must be concluded and the participants selected before fees are assessed. Some of the listed fees are subject to Utah state sales tax. In addition to the fees listed on this fee schedule, the Board authorizes fines for damage caused to district property and for violating rules of conduct. Because administrative penalties do not implicate participation in school sponsored activities, fines are not waivable and do not appear on this schedule.

*Pursuant to Utah Code 53A-11-102.6 and Utah Administrative Rule R277-494-3, students who attend a charter school or home school and participate in extracurricular activities must pay a $75 fee in addition to all related participation fees.
Fees, as identified by the Wasatch School Board of Education, will be waived in accordance with the Utah State Board of Education standards for students whose parents or legal guardians verify evidence of inability to pay. Inability to pay is defined as those who are in state custody, foster care, or receiving public assistance in the form of Aid for Dependent Children, Supplemental Security Income, or are eligible according to most  current Income Eligibility Guidelines; and, that case-by-case determinations are made for those who do not qualify under one of the foregoing standards, but who, because of extenuating circumstances such as, but not limited to, exceptional financial burdens such as loss of substantial reduction of income or extraordinary medical expenses, are not reasonably capable of paying the fee. (The receipt of unemployment compensation and/  or reduced price school lunch does not constitute public assistance as defined above.)  Please note that costs for non-curricular clubs, yearbooks, class rings, letter jackets, school pictures, and similar items which are not required for participation in a class or activity are not fees and will not be waived. Students may be required to pay fees for concurrent enrollment or advanced placement courses. The portion of the fees related   specifically to college or post-secondary grades or credit is not subject to fee waiver.
